Spiritual Awakening and Narcissism: A Journey Towards Self-Reflection

When the terms “spiritual awakening” and “narcissism” are juxtaposed, it may seem like an unusual pairing. After all, spiritual awakening is often associated with personal growth, compassion, and selflessness, while narcissism is typically linked to selfishness, self-centeredness, and an inflated sense of self-importance. However, the intersection between spiritual awakening and narcissism is not as incongruous as it may initially appear. In fact, there is an intriguing relationship between the two, characterized by profound personal transformation and a journey towards self-reflection.

Understanding Spiritual Awakening

Before delving into the connection between spiritual awakening and narcissism, it is important to grasp the fundamentals of a spiritual awakening. A spiritual awakening is an intensely personal and transformative experience in which an individual undergoes a profound shift in consciousness, leading to a heightened awareness of their inner self and the world around them. It is often described as a moment of profound enlightenment or a transcendence of ego-bound limitations.

A spiritual awakening can manifest in various ways, from a sudden epiphany to a gradual unfolding of self-discovery and spiritual growth. Some common indicators of a spiritual awakening include:

  • Deep introspection and self-inquiry
  • Increased empathy and compassion
  • Heightened intuition and inner guidance
  • Greater connection to nature and the universe
  • Shifts in priorities and values
  • Desire for personal and collective healing

The Paradox of Narcissism and Spiritual Awakening

On the surface, narcissism and spiritual awakening may appear to be contradictory. Narcissism is typically characterized by self-centeredness, a lack of empathy, and an obsessive focus on personal achievement and validation. Spiritual awakening, on the other hand, entails a deep understanding of interconnectedness, empathy, and a transcendence of the ego. However, the link between spiritual awakening and narcissism lies in the process of self-reflection and transformation that can occur during the journey.

At its core, narcissism stems from deep-rooted insecurity, a fear of vulnerability, and an inability to truly connect with others. Narcissists often maintain a façade of superiority and grandiosity to shield themselves from emotional pain and maintain a sense of control. However, beneath this self-aggrandizing exterior lies a profound fear of inadequacy and a yearning for genuine self-worth.

During a spiritual awakening, individuals are compelled to confront their deepest fears and insecurities. The process of self-reflection and inner work unravels layers of conditioning, exposing the root causes of one’s self-centeredness and narcissistic tendencies. It presents an opportunity for the individual to acknowledge their woundedness, face their shadow self, and embark on a journey towards healing and self-transformation.

The Role of Narcissism in the Spiritual Awakening Process

While narcissistic traits may hinder spiritual growth and connection, they can also play a crucial role in the awakening process. Narcissism serves as a catalyst for self-examination, forcing individuals to confront their ego-driven patterns and confront the underlying wounds that fuel their self-centeredness.

By recognizing the destructive nature of their narcissistic tendencies, individuals are compelled to embark on a journey of self-inquiry and self-discovery. The painful experiences and consequences often associated with narcissism can serve as powerful motivators for change, triggering a profound desire for personal growth, transformation, and genuine connection with others.

It is important to note that the spiritual awakening process is not a quick fix for narcissism. It requires deep introspection, inner work, and a willingness to confront and heal past traumas. However, the combination of spiritual awakening and self-reflection provides individuals with the tools and guidance to navigate their journey towards self-transformation.

Healing Narcissism Through Spiritual Awakening

Healing narcissism through spiritual awakening is a complex and multifaceted process. Here are some key steps individuals may take on their journey towards healing and self-transformation:

  1. Surrendering to the Process: Embracing vulnerability and surrendering to the process of self-reflection and inner healing is the first step towards transformation. It requires individuals to let go of the need for control and to be open to the guidance of higher consciousness.
  2. Self-Compassion: Cultivating self-compassion is essential in breaking the cycle of self-centeredness. Treating oneself with empathy and kindness allows for greater self-understanding and paves the way for emotional healing.
  3. Shadow Work: Confronting and integrating the shadow self—the parts of ourselves that we reject or deny—is an integral part of healing narcissism. This involves acknowledging and accepting our own imperfections, weaknesses, and insecurities.
  4. Cultivating Empathy and Connection: Developing empathy and genuine connection with others lies at the heart of healing narcissism. It involves active listening, seeking understanding, and practicing compassion in relationships.
  5. Transcending the Ego: The spiritual awakening journey ultimately entails transcending the ego and recognizing the interconnectedness of all beings. This shift in consciousness allows individuals to move beyond self-centeredness and embrace a more expansive perspective.

The Continuing Journey

Healing narcissism through spiritual awakening is not a linear process, nor does it have a definitive endpoint. It is a continuous journey of self-reflection, growth, and evolution. As individuals deepen their spiritual connection and expand their awareness, they may encounter new challenges and opportunities for healing.

It is important to approach this journey with patience, self-compassion, and a commitment to personal growth. Seeking support from trusted spiritual mentors, therapists, or support groups can also provide valuable guidance and insight along the way.
